EasyMalwareBlocker Home Description

EasyMalwareBlocker efficiently blocks any attempts to clandestinely install unwanted malicious software of any kind (including rootkits) that may occur while surfing the Internet. These threats have become more common recently and now pose one of the biggest risk for your computer.
Not all of other Security Programs can prevent drive-by-downloads, if they do they use difficult to maintain malware reference lists; many only find them after they have been installed. Give EasyMalwareBlocker a try to fully assess its capabilities!
Note: Some antivirus and antispyware programs flag EasyMalwareBlocker as being infected/malware, although the application is perfectly safe and does not pose a threat to your system. This is called a false positive. The term false positive is used when antivirus software wrongly classifies an innocuous ( inoffensive ) file as a virus. The incorrect detection may be due to heuristics or to an incorrect virus signature in a database. [Similar problems can occur with antitrojan or antispyware software.]
